About Kerv Digital

Kerv Digital helps its customers create a positive social impact, and build a future through digital transformation with a human touch. As such, Kerv’s transformation projects have a highly unique, collaborative way of working, enabling Kerv to always put usability at the forefront of its digital solutions. However, Kerv has historically struggled to have a ‘grassroots’ movement of employees that would rise people through the ranks. This is where Revolent really came into its own, equipping Kerv with delivery-ready Microsoft talent or ‘Revols’ from a wider range of backgrounds.

Meet the talent

Meet Kyle Boardman, one of the many Revols deployed at Kerv Digital, delivering impactful work with a real passion to learn.

A background in tech and linguistics

Kyle graduated from King’s College, London, with a degree in English Linguistics. Following this, he went into tech sales, working as an Account Manager selling Enterprise Solutions. With a keen passion for linguistics, digital anthropology, and digital transformation, combined with his experience in technical sales, e-commerce, and business strategy, Kyle seemed like the perfect match for Kerv Digital.

When Revolent reached out to Kyle, he decided to join our Microsoft talent program, attracted by the intensity of the training and the prospect of being placed with Kerv—a client that would value his existing skill sets and future work.

Getting Kyle ready to work on-site

Kyle cross-trained as a Functional Consultant, earning 3 Microsoft certifications. During this time, he also completed professional soft skills training (including effective project management techniques, consultant’s communication toolkit, and stakeholder management, among other crucial skills) before being deployed to work on-site at Kerv, ready to make an impact from day one.

Kyle's new role and responsibilities

In his time at Kerv, Kyle has worked on a number of impactful tasks, including a transformation project that involved onboarding Kerv’s company businesses onto a unified CRM platform. He enjoyed shipping the first release to end-users, watching them use the system, and engage with it as designed.

Thanks to his dedication and passion for growth, Kerv has since offered Kyle a full-time position as an Analyst Developer which he has accepted.
